Are there 7 11s in Australia?
About 7-Eleven Australia 7-Eleven is the largest petrol and convenience retailer in Australia, based on market share. Today 7-Eleven operates more than 700 stores in Victoria, New South Wales, the Australian Capital Territory, Queensland and Western Australia.
Why is the 711 lowercase n?
“A graphics designer altered the “n” during the updating of the logo. In the 1960s, the ELEVEN part of the brand name had been capitalized and at a slight angle through the 7. When the Eleven was straightened out, the designer recommended that the ‘n’ be lowercase for smoothness of the graphic.”

How many bottles of Beer can you buy at BWS?
“To ensure there is enough for everyone, there is now a per customer, per shop limit on all beer, wine & spirits, in store and online,” BWS said online. A limit of four cases of beer, premixed drinks and cider applies, as well as a purchase limit of four bottles of spirits, three casks or 12 bottles of wine.
